- The distance between Salvador, Brazil and Bonthe, Sierra Leone is approximately 3,672 km or 2,282 mi.
- To reach Salvador in this distance one would set out from Bonthe bearing 231.7°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Salvador bearing 232.9° or SW .
- Salvador has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Bonthe has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The mean temperature is 1.5 °C (2.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.3 °C (0.5°F) more in Salvador.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1565.6 mm (61.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1565.6 l/m² (38.42 US gal/ft²) or 15,656,000 l/ha (1,673,730 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.3° lower in Salvador than in Bonthe.
